    The Summer Club Chair I

    Is a cross between, a piece out of Enzo Mari’s 1974 Auroprogettazione Manuel, and a scrapbook of 70s era magazine cut-outs.
    All images are original, limited edition Été Rétro ™ posters.

    Each piece is handcrafted. Hence, it has its own charm.

    H 30′ x W15′ x D15′
    Recycled Plywood

    $2900

    Summer Club Cabanon I

    A homage to the architect Le Corbusier.
    This is a cross between the iconic Corbusier stool box, designed in the 50s for his fisherman’s hut in the French Riviera, and a scrapbook of 70s era magazine cut-outs.

    Four sides in original
    Été Rétro ™ posters, rectangular slots, and two sides exposed in chestnut stain.

    Each piece is handcrafted. Hence, it has its own charm.

    To be used as stool, coffee table, sculpture, stacked boxes, or single.

    Recycled Plywood.
    H 17′ x W 13′ x D 11′

    $1250
